A listing of historical London public houses, Taverns, Inns, Beer Houses and Hotels in Southwark St Saviour, Surrey, London. The Southwark St Saviour, Surrey , London listing uses information from census, Trade Directories and History to add licensees, bar staff, Lodgers and Visitors.
The following entries are in this format:
Year/Publican or other Resident/Relationship to Head and or Occupation/Age/Where Born/Source.
In 1848, West Diggers is at the Sword Buckler & Bulls head, 40 Bermondsey
street
1851/West Digges/../../../Kellys Directory ****
1851/West Digges/Brewer & Victualler/50/Ireland/Census ****
1851/Maria Digges/Wife/35/Camberwell, Surrey/Census
1851/West R Digges/Son/17/Camberwell, Surrey/Census
1851/Louisa Digges/Daughter/14/Camberwell, Surrey/Census
1851/Harriet Digges/Daughter/10/Woking, Surrey/Census
1851/Delaware Digges/Son/5/Bermondsey, Surrey/Census
1851/Cicely Digges/Daughter/1/Southwark, Surrey/Census
1851/Sarah White/Sister in Law, Domestic Servant/25/Camberwell,
Surrey/Census
